Two men arrested after victim mowed down by car in Chatham

A victim was left seriously injured after being mown down by a car in an attack.

Police are seeking witnesses after a car containing two people was driven at two pedestrians in Institute Road, Chatham, at around 11.15pm on Thursday, November 4.

One of the pedestrians was seriously injured following the collision and officers subsequently arrested a man in his 20s from Sheerness and a second man in his 40s from Chatham.

Following inquiries and a review of CCTV, officers are looking for witnesses who may be able to identify other people who may have been in the car at the time.

The suspects and victims are believed to be known to each other.

Anybody with information is urged to call Kent Police on 01795 419119, quoting reference number 46/224473/21.
